Herbie Hall
Herbert Henry Hall was a British wrestler who competed at two Olympic Games.
Biography
Hall was a notable Lancashire catch-as-catch-can wrestler and a ten-time British freestyle wrestling champion. He won the British freestyle featherweight championship, at the British Wrestling Championships from 1952–1957, 1961, and 1963, and the lightweight championship in 1958 and 1959.Hall competed at the 1952 Summer Olympics and the 1956 Summer Olympics.
He represented the English team at the 1954 British Empire and Commonwealth Games held in Vancouver, Canada, where he won the silver medal in the featherweight category. He also represented represented the England team in the -68kg division at the 1958 British Empire and Commonwealth Games in Cardiff, Wales.
